About the role
This attorney will be involved in real estate matters throughout the country. Our ideal associate candidate would have three to four years of experience in real estate-related law, including specifically drafting and negotiating purchase and sale and ancillary agreements, leasing, and financing of commercial real estate. Experience with real estate development and land use permitting process would be helpful. Excellent writing skills, attention to detail, and very strong academic credentials are required.
